Compacting Transactional Data in Hybrid OLTP&OLAP Databases
Summary: Compact in-memory HTAP DBs by separating mutable working data from immutable frozen data. Asynchronous background compression reorganizes and compresses frozen data to speed snapshotting while preserving near-OLTP throughput.
